    Cloud Save Bugginess


    Today when launching Dragon Age my xbox popped up a "we couldn't get your latest saved data" message. Network settings reported all services were fine. I signed out my profile, signed back in, and relaunched the game. The error message went away. However,
    all my save data from yesterday is gone.

    At no point yesterday did the game or the console report any kind of problem saving, any kind of network outage, or any kind of service interruption. Is it possible to disable cloud saving entirely and just use local saves until such time as the services' basic
    functionality works reliably?

  4. Cloud Save Bugginess

    Cloud saving doesn't really work like that. It always saves to your console first, then uploads it to the cloud, should it not fully upload, it will still remain on your console intact, and always use the saves on your console. The cloud is just a back-up
    as well as a convenient way to transfer saves to another console.

    I would think there was a problem saving the game, either the game was exited before the save could complete, or the console was shut down to quickly. Or it could just be that the save corrupted, which can happen.

    To answer your question though, the only way to effectively disable cloud saves is to play offline.
